Transaction 2072651ed68b36878df1ea09fadcacd8295c2d9c33a97a6f387d9b25c40ce2c6
1 Input
1 Output
-
2072651ed68b36878df1ea09fadcacd8295c2d9c33a97a6f387d9b25c40ce2c6:0
- value
- 7476431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7fee19811304a468846ab9fbde531e9f0892b70 OP_EQUAL
- address
- 3QJJAPDts1Vfb46mrxRsYhWc1HPEQYByxK